The street in brief

The Turnpike is a street almost entirely of det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£224,500 — roughly 25% below the SN15 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£2,815, below the district's £3,448.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across SN15 prices have been easing over the last few years. The record shows 10 sales across 5 homes since 2001.

The Turnpike's £224,500 median sits about 25% below SN15's £297,500; on floor space it runs £2,815/m² against the district's £3,448/m² (-18%).

Street and SN15 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
